New Jersey roots rocker DownTown Mystic (aka Robert Allen) returns with a very cool new project. Over last two years The Static Dive has featured a slew of new music from Allen and his cohorts at Sha-La Music. The independent music publishing company and record label is home to DownTown Mystic’s music as well as that of associated artists like guitarist Bruce Engler. Readers of The Static Dive have been lucky enough to be the first to hear songs from DTM’s 2020 album “Better Day” and the 2021 album “DownTown Mystic On E Street Deluxe” which featured Hall of Fame inductees Max Weinberg and Garry Tallent of Bruce Springsteen’s E Street Band.

“Downtown Demos” is the latest EP from DownTown Mystic and Sha-La Music, released worldwide to all major streaming services on Friday September 10, 2021. The EP is an experiment of sorts. Allen is currently working on the next DTM album. The ‘demos’ of the EP are early versions of songs that will eventually be re-recorded and included on the new album. DTM teamed up with production team ‘Bong Bros’ to package the demos as an interactive experience, involving fans in the entire album creation process.

The idea is to show the process of how the project proceeds in real-time, from demo to finished product.

Robert Allen (DownTown Mystic)

The six tracks on “Downtown Demos” include instrumental and vocal versions of rootsy rockers “(I Want to) Live” and “Shadow Walk.” Each matches tasty Blues guitar with lo-fi beats and soulful, raspy Southern Rock-style singing (on the vocal versions). The instrumental “Koolskool” is a real highpoint featuring 2:38 seconds of smoking guitar riffing and solos. “Acoustic Heart” is an instrumental take of a Country/Pop/Rock track that already sounds like a hit.

The new DownTown Mystic EP “Downtown Demos” is a fascinating peek inside the creative process of a deeply talented team of musicians. It’s also a lot of fun.
